Dwayne C Swanson 1903 - 1970

Dwayne C Swanson of Minneapolis, Hennepin County, MN was born on April 15, 1903, and died at age 67 years old on September 7, 1970. Dwayne Swanson was buried at Ft. Snelling National Cemetery Section N Site 2620 7601 34th Avenue, South, in Minneapolis.

Did you know?
In 1903, in the year that Dwayne C Swanson was born, the first World Series of American baseball was played between October 1st and 13th. The Boston Americans of the American League played the Pittsburgh Pirates of the National League. Boston came back from a three game to one deficit, winning the final four games to capture the title - such a large comeback wouldn't be repeated by a team until 1925. (A total of eight games were played.)
